The 'look' of lenses depends on many factors including the subject matter. As stated, under some situations, you may not see much difference between lenses. I think when people talk about a 'look', they are typically referring to some combination of micro detail and macro detail - a sort of 'shape of the MTF curve' if you will.

I would say the following categories of lenses would form a good categorization to go wading through stuff. Keep in mind that differnet designs are trying to optimize different things (either coverage or resolution or off axis performance etc etc). The categroization is mostly historic in nature and follows from Kingslake's books...

1) Portrait or soft focus: Probably the greatest variation 'within-catgeory' is to be found here. The typical soft focus lens has uncorrected spherical aberration. This results in a 'glow' around the highlights (see AA's "Lodgepole Pines" for an example). The range of lenses here is vast with different lenses providing substantially different looks - brass rectlinears, Kodak SF, Wollensak had a vast stable (Veritos, Velostigmat Ser II in certain lengths, Vitax), and the most recent would probably be the Rodenstock Imagons.

2) Rapid rectilinears: Probably the most abundantly available pre-anastigmat. Noticeably softer than more recent designs, especially off-axis.

3) Anastigmats: The classic designs here are the Dagor and the Protar VII. The Dagor is 2 groups of 3 elements each - the Protar is 2 groups of 4 elements each. Similar looks - the tradeoff is The Protar is better as a convrtible, the Dagor typically gives slightly better coverage. The performance is noticeably better than astigmats. 4) Dialyte: Artars to more recent Ronars etc. 4 elemts in 4 groups. Apochromatic performance. Known as process lenses and as wonderfully sharp landscape lenses.

5) Tessars: Widely available. Think of it as the plain vanilla. Not terribly exciting but forms a good comparison point.

6) Plasmats: More recent designs - typically bigger and heavier and somewhat 'clinical' look - at least, the Dagor folks will say there is no 'look' to it...;-)

7) Wide angles: Where recent designs have probably covered the most ground. Early wide angles include things like Protar V, Goerz Hypergon, Goerz wide angle Dagor etc. With the Super Angulon etc, you do get much greater coverage, making more wode angle designs feasible.

Wide angle lenses are also where the most obvious differences are, as recently mentioned in a thread on a Leitmeyr Weitwinkel-anastigmat.

The Goerz Hypergon is often the easiest one to pick, since no lens before or after has come close to the 135 degrees coverage. If there is no falloff away from the center, it's a Hypergon with the fan "graduate filter".

WA Rectilinears can be surprisingly good, but when stretched beyond the limit (which they often are) they go to mush in the corners. See http://www.flickr.com/photo_zoom.gne?id=1396906969&context=photostream&size=o for an example (3 1/4" WA Rectilinear on 4x5" Provia; cropped)

The Protar f:18 (series V in the US market) has good coverage, reasonably sharp all over, but suffers from severe falloff.

So does the WA Dagor, with less coverage than the Protar.

Double Gauss WA lenses generally cut off very abruptly at the edge of coverage. Examples are Meyer Weitwinkel-Aristostigmats, and most Leitmeyr WW-Anastigmats.

Angulons (reverse dagor with oversize outer elements) have more even illumination, and illuminate more than the coverage. Several redesigns through 60 years of production makes it easier to date an Angulon from a photograph than to determine if it was shot with an Angulon...

Super Angulons and other "wasp-waist" WA lenses are very similar in concept, and not really possible to distinguish. All have almost cos^3 falloff, as opposed to cos^4 for the smaller older ones.

Throwing in my random observations on general-use lenses, most will give very similar results. The biggest difference is whether they are uncoated or coated, especially on designs with more air-glass surfaces, like the plasmat. With an uncoated lens, contrast is lost and shadow detail softened due to flare, especially in backlit situations. I like using the old uncoated optics, but others don't. The difference in contrast between single- and multi-coated lenses is relatively slight.

Dagors have fairly wide coverage, but some go rather soft at the corners. Others don't.

Plasmats do it all very well, wide coverage, sharp at the corners, and they're convertable.

Tessars are lovely, but some have narrower coverage. Then again, some have pretty wide coverage, like the 450-M Nikkor. (There's also a "wide-field tessar", but I've never seen one...) They were design in 1902, and are still in production, but then nearly all the modern lenses are pretty old designs...

Dialytes tend to have pretty narrow coverage, but are very nice if you want a longer lens. But they also tend to be a bit darker, often with a maximum aperture of f/9.

I hope you understand something about the fundamentals of optics.

First, you should know how to relate focal length to angle of view for the format. 300 mm would be the "normal" focal length for 8 x 10 since it is close to the diagonal of the frame. 240 mm would be a mildly wide angle focal length.

You should also understand the basics of depth of field, which is dependent both of focal length and format. For the same size final image and same angle of view, the larger the format, the less depth of field. This could create problems for portraiture. For this reason, large format photographers often do environmental photography, usually full figure well back from the camera with the local environment being an important part of the scene. This is even more true for 8 x 10 than it would be for 4 x 5. Also, longer lenses, which are often favored for closer up portraiture, may be difficult to find for the 8 x 10 format.
